What Is Gait Analysis?
When carried out by professional physical therapists, gait analysis is an assessment of how you move, specifically how you walk and run. By understanding how you move, your physical therapist can offer insights into muscle imbalances, injury risks, the progress of injury recovery, and more. Because our gaits our the product of a multitude of factors – strength, flexibility, coordination, vision, the vestibular system – gait analysis can provide a valuable look at your overall movement health.
In a gait analysis appointment, your Axes physical therapist in Granite City, IL will look at:
- Step length and width
- Cadence (number of steps taken per minute)
- Foot and ankle alignment to see if you have tendencies towards pronation (inward rolling) or supination (outward rolling)
- Joint movement and range of motion
- Movement of the pelvis to see if there is excessive rotating or titling
- Stability, balance, and body sway (the amount of lateral movement)
- Step repeatability (the similarity of your steps)

Two Types of Gait Analysis
There are generally two major types of gait analysis:
- Qualitative gait analysis — Also known as clinical gait analysis, this method entails a physical therapist directly watching your gait as you walk and via video recordings. It enables the physical therapist to obtain a broad overview of your mobility health and easily identify any observable patterns. Qualitative gait analysis depends on the professional judgment of the therapist to reach conclusions.
- Quantitative gait analysis — Also known as instrument-assisted gait analysis, this approach employs advanced technology, including sensors and motion capture software, to offer objective, quantifiable data regarding your gait. By using precise numerical values, it enables more thorough analysis and monitoring of your progress over a period of time.
